Saw some oil leaking, its dark and dirty. Doesnt look like transmission oil, transmission oil is more reddish than dirty black. More like engine oil. Where is leak coming from? What could be the problem? The engine head gasket area doesnt have any leak, oil filter side no leak. There is no leak coming from the top part of the engine.

Certainly looks like engine oil. Rocker cover or cam carrier leaks are not unknown on this engine.

Finally went to workshop and had the flywheel gasket, torque converter oil seal, drive shaft oil seal replaced. Now everything is good. The oil leak is from the engine oil.
